The Journey Begins Early: Pickup and Transport

Starting with a 7:00 AM pickup from your hotel in Ho Chi Minh City, the tour ensures you beat the crowds and make the most of daylight. The air-conditioned vehicle offers a comfortable ride through the countryside, which can take approximately 4 to 4.5 hours depending on traffic. The journey itself is a chance to relax and get a glimpse of Vietnam’s bustling outskirts giving way to calmer coastal scenery.

First Stop: The Local Fishing Village

Arriving at the fishing village of Suoi Tien, you’ll see wooden boats used by local fishermen. One review highlighted how the guide, Linh, was exceptionally knowledgeable about the area’s fishing traditions, making the visit both educational and visually interesting. You’ll notice the lively atmosphere, with boats bobbing in the water and local fishermen preparing for their day. This stop offers a genuine look into the everyday life of coastal residents—an authentic contrast to tourist-heavy beaches.

The Fairy Stream: A Mini Wonderland

Next, you’ll walk along the Fairy Stream, a petite waterway winding through striking red sand dunes. The stream’s shallow waters and unique landscape resemble a smaller version of famous canyon scenes, which makes for fantastic photos. Travelers have appreciated how Linh explained the geological formation and the significance of the red and white sands, enriching the experience beyond just sightseeing. The walk is gentle, making it suitable for most fitness levels, and the cool water provides a refreshing break.

Lunch at a Local Restaurant

After exploring the Fairy Stream, a local restaurant serves up traditional Vietnamese fare. Many reviews mention how the lunch was satisfying and well-portioned, giving good energy for the rest of the day. The meal typically includes fresh seafood and rice, set in a simple but inviting environment. It’s a perfect way to support local businesses and enjoy authentic flavors.

Relaxing at Mui Ne Beach

Post-lunch, you’ll have free time at Mui Ne Beach, arguably the most relaxing part of the day. Sitting under coconut palms with your feet in the sand, you can soak up the tranquil vibe and watch local kids playing or fishermen returning with their catch. The beach is known for its gentle waves and warm waters, making it a safe and inviting spot for swimming or just unwinding.

The Sand Dunes: White & Red

The highlight for many travelers is the visit to the White Sand Dunes (Bau Trang) and the Red Sand Dunes.

  • At the White Sand Dunes, you might choose to rent an ATV, which many reviews describe as a fun, if slightly thrilling, way to explore the terrain. The expansive white dunes are otherworldly, with a quiet serenity that appeals to photographers and nature lovers alike.
  • The Red Sand Dunes, with their softer slopes, provide stunning vistas especially during the sunset. Visitors often mention how the red hue contrasted beautifully against the evening sky, creating perfect photo moments. The slopes are gentler here, making it an accessible spot for those who want to enjoy the scenery without strenuous climbs.

Sunset and Return Trip

As the day winds down, you’ll gather at the Red Sand Dunes to witness a spectacular sunset. Many reviews note this as a truly memorable part of the tour—cooler air, vibrant colors, and the peaceful sound of the wind through the dunes. Afterward, the journey back to Ho Chi Minh City begins, ending with drops at major locations like Ben Thanh Market and the Saigon Opera House.

Practical Tips

  • Wear comfortable shoes suitable for walking on sand and uneven terrain.
  • Bring sunscreen and a hat—the sun can be intense, especially during midday.
  • A camera is essential for capturing the stunning landscapes and candid village scenes.
  • If you plan to rent an ATV or jeep, budget extra, as these are not included.
  • The tour isn’t suitable for pregnant women, those with back problems, or wheelchair users due to the nature of activities and terrain.
